The Last Day

Some believed that the world was going to end on December 21, 2012. Some scientists have now put forward a radical theory that this did not, in fact, happen. Controversial theories aside, one thing universally agreed upon is that jefftheworld's album "The Last Day" was released that day and it was pretty darn neat.

You can grab an mp3 of any song by clicking the respective download button or grab the whole album in a zip archive as mp3 or flac.